Citizen is adding a fresh new piece to its Marvel collaboration lineup with the upcoming Citizen Black Panther 60th Anniversary watch, model AW1858-03W. Recently spotted in a U.S. retail listing, the watch reveals a bold Wakanda-inspired look and a set of practical, everyday specs that should appeal to both collectors and anyone who simply wants a striking Eco-Drive timepiece on the wrist.

The Citizen Black Panther AW1858-03W follows earlier releases in the same collaboration family, expanding the range with a distinctive black-and-green theme inspired by T’Challa, the King of Wakanda. This new edition leans heavily into character-driven design without sacrificing the clean, wearable style that Citizen’s modern sport watches are known for.

Front and center is a standout dial built around a triangular pattern in green, black, and white. A gold Black Panther mask logo sits in the middle, giving the watch a clear signature element that immediately sets it apart. Around the edge, the minute track brings in subtle purple accents, adding another nod to the Black Panther aesthetic while keeping the overall design cohesive. The dial is framed by a black ion-plated stainless steel bezel for a darker, stealthier finish.

The case measures 42 mm wide, a versatile size that fits comfortably into today’s popular sport-watch dimensions. On the back, the case is engraved to mark the Black Panther 60th anniversary, reinforcing the collectible nature of the release. Citizen pairs the case with a black silicone strap, a practical choice that suits the watch’s sporty, ready-for-anything character and keeps it comfortable for daily wear.

In terms of functionality, the AW1858-03W keeps things streamlined and useful. You get three analog hands and a straightforward date display—exactly the kind of setup that works well for an everyday watch without cluttering the dial. Power comes from Citizen’s J810 Eco-Drive movement, designed to run on light from virtually any source, which means no routine battery changes and less long-term maintenance.

Durability is also a strong point here. The dial is protected by sapphire crystal, a premium material prized for its scratch resistance. The watch is also rated for 100 meters of water resistance, making it suitable for swimming and general water exposure, though it’s always wise to follow brand guidance for specific water activities.

Pricing details from the listing point to a retail price of $450. At the moment, it’s shown as “temporarily out of stock,” and there’s no confirmed timing yet for when it will officially become available in the U.S. There’s also no announcement so far on a broader international release, so fans of Citizen’s Marvel watches may want to keep an eye out for updates as more launch information emerges.
